GENERAL CHAMPIONSHIP RULES
Athletes take part at their own risk. No claim may be made against KSA – WKF or any of the officials officiating on the day of the championship. It is the responsibility of every Provincial Coach to explain the conditions/ rules to each athlete and or parent before entering the championship. Any athlete entered in an incorrect age or weight will be disqualified. Coaches and Team Managers must ensure that correct information is submitted. Any athlete not reporting to his/her floor after 3-call out will be disqualified. Kata rules for the Development Championship section for all ages: A minimum one kata to be performed and it may be repeated as many times as required. (they may do more than 1 kata BUT once they change they cannot go back and repeat previous kata) Athletes must use WKF Approved Protective gear. All Athletes must use ALL WKF required protective equipment. ATHLETES MUST HAVE RED AND BLUE MITS, RED AND BLUE BELTS, RED and BLUE SHINFOOT PROTECTORS(Red and Blue), CHEST PROTECTION, GUM GUARDS. Breast Protection for Girls/ Ladies Kumite: years will require a win margin of 6 points. Kumite: 14 years and above: will require a win margin of 8 points (as per WKF) Coaches: Only the appointed coaches from each provinces may coach an athlete from his/ her province. Only coaches wearing their full provincial tracksuit will be allowed to coach. Those wearing only tracksuit top or trouser/ Protea track suit wont be allowed on the floor. WKF rules on coaching must be strictly adhered to and non compliance to the rule and regulation disciplinary steps may be taken. Team Managers: Team Managers must wear their official Provincial Attire (Navy blue blazer, white shirt, tie, gray pants, black shoes & socks) Team Managers are not allowed in competition area
